Five deaths and 345 cases recorded in NSW on Friday October 22 2021 – The Young Witness
The new cases were detected through 76,594 tests conducted during the 24-hour period to 8pm on Thursday.
FIVE more people have died as NSW added 345 additional cases to its COVID-19 tally.
Vaccination rates continue to climb steadily, with 92.7 per cent of people over the age of 16 vaccinated with one dose. For double doses, the figure is 83 per cent.
